What is a Hose Clamp?


A hose clamp is a device used to attach and seal a hose onto a fitting, which can be a pipe or another hose. It works by exerting a radial force on the hose, ensuring a snug fit that prevents leaks. Hose clamps come in various styles and sizes, catering to different industrial, automotive, and domestic needs.

Applications of the Number 204 Hose Clamp


1. Automotive Use The automotive industry relies heavily on hose clamps for various components, such as coolant, fuel, and vacuum lines. The Number 204 hose clamp is often used to secure radiator hoses, ensuring that coolant flows smoothly without leaks.


2. Industrial Machinery In industrial settings, these hose clamps help secure hydraulic and pneumatic hoses, preventing disruptions in systems that operate under high pressure. The reliability of the Number 204 clamp allows industries to maintain operational efficiency.


3. Home Improvement Many home improvement projects involve plumbing and HVAC systems. The Number 204 hose clamp can be used to secure hoses in these systems, ensuring proper function and preventing leaks.


4. Agricultural Equipment Farmers use hose clamps in various equipment and irrigation systems to secure hoses for transporting water or nutrients, highlighting the clamp's versatility.

Best Practices for Use


To ensure optimal performance from your Number 204 hose clamp, follow these best practices


1. Select the Right Size Always choose a clamp that correctly fits the hose diameter. An incorrectly sized clamp may not provide an adequate seal.


2. Proper Installation When installing the clamp, ensure that it is evenly positioned around the hose. Tighten the screw mechanism evenly to avoid crushing the hose.


3. Regular Maintenance Periodically inspect the clamp for signs of wear or corrosion, especially in harsh environments. Replace any damaged clamps to maintain system integrity.


4. Avoid Over-tightening While it’s essential to secure the clamp, over-tightening can lead to damage to the hose itself.
